Capillaries
The smallest blood vessels in the body, responsible for the exchange of oxygen, carbon dioxide, and other nutrients and waste products between the blood and tissues.
Arteries
Blood vessels that carry oxygen-rich blood away from the heart to the body's tissues, characterized by their strong, elastic walls.
Atrioventricular Valve
Valves located between the atria and ventricles of the heart that prevent the backflow of blood during ventricular contraction.
Semilunar Valve
Valve resembling a half-moon, located between the ventricles and their attached vessels.
